Department of Aeronautics and Astronautics, Stanford University, 496 Lomita Mall, Stanford, CA 94305, USA.
Sensors (Basel). 2011;11(9):8966-91. doi: 10.3390/s110908966. Epub 2011 Sep 19.
Due to their weak received signal power, Global Positioning System (GPS) signals are vulnerable to radio frequency interference. Adaptive beam and null steering of the gain pattern of a GPS antenna array can significantly increase the resistance of GPS sensors to signal interference and jamming. Since adaptive array processing requires intensive computational power, beamsteering GPS receivers were usually implemented using hardware such as field-programmable gate arrays (FPGAs). However, a software implementation using general-purpose processors is much more desirable because of its flexibility and cost effectiveness. This paper presents a GPS software-defined radio (SDR) with adaptive beamsteering capability for anti-jam applications. The GPS SDR design is based on an optimized desktop parallel processing architecture using a quad-core Central Processing Unit (CPU) coupled with a new generation Graphics Processing Unit (GPU) having massively parallel processors. This GPS SDR demonstrates sufficient computational capability to support a four-element antenna array and future GPS L5 signal processing in real time. After providing the details of our design and optimization schemes for future GPU-based GPS SDR developments, the jamming resistance of our GPS SDR under synthetic wideband jamming is presented. Since the GPS SDR uses commercial-off-the-shelf hardware and processors, it can be easily adopted in civil GPS applications requiring anti-jam capabilities.
由于其接收信号功率较弱,全球定位系统 (GPS) 信号容易受到射频干扰。自适应波束形成和增益模式的零陷控制可以显著提高 GPS 传感器对信号干扰和干扰的抵抗能力。由于自适应阵列处理需要密集的计算能力,因此通常使用现场可编程门阵列 (FPGA) 等硬件来实现波束控制 GPS 接收器。然而,使用通用处理器的软件实现由于其灵活性和成本效益而更受青睐。本文提出了一种具有自适应波束控制能力的 GPS 软件定义无线电 (SDR),用于抗干扰应用。GPS SDR 设计基于使用四核中央处理单元 (CPU) 优化的桌面并行处理架构,并结合具有大规模并行处理器的新一代图形处理单元 (GPU)。该 GPS SDR 具有足够的计算能力,可支持四元件天线阵列和未来实时 GPS L5 信号处理。在提供未来基于 GPU 的 GPS SDR 开发的设计和优化方案的详细信息后,展示了我们的 GPS SDR 在合成宽带干扰下的抗干扰能力。由于 GPS SDR 使用商用现货硬件和处理器,因此可以轻松应用于需要抗干扰能力的民用 GPS 应用。